P/E Ratio Analysis

As of June 21, 2026, Kimberly-Clark Corporation (KMB) trades at a price-to-earnings ratio of 16.9x, with a stock price of $102.56 and trailing twelve-month earnings per share of $6.36.

The current P/E is 22% below its 5-year average of 21.7x. Over the past five years, KMB's P/E has ranged from a low of 15.1x to a high of 28.5x, placing the current valuation at the 10th percentile of its historical range.

Compared to the Consumer Defensive sector median P/E of 18.9x, KMB is roughly in line with its sector peers. The sector includes 151 companies with P/E ratios ranging from 0.0x to 193.7x.

Relative to the broader market, KMB trades at a notable discount to the S&P 500 median P/E of 24.4x. Investors should consider the company's growth prospects, competitive position, and earnings quality when evaluating whether the current valuation is justified.

What is KMB's earnings yield?

KMB earnings yield is 5.92%, the inverse of its 16.9x P/E ratio. Earnings yield represents the percentage of each dollar invested that the company earns. It can be compared directly to bond yields to assess relative attractiveness of stocks versus fixed income.
